Problems solved by technology

[0002] The rear positioning structure of the CNC sheet metal bending machine in the prior art is usually formed by connecting several parts by welding or bolt positioning. It is difficult to meet the high-precision installation requirements between the components, and the products cannot achieve standardized production. , product quality is difficult to guarantee
In addition, during the use of the product, accidental collisions of tools and workpieces will cause damage to guide rails, lead screws and other components, which will affect the transmission accuracy and the stability of motion. Iron filings or long-term dust accumulation will also cause wear and tear on transmission components. , thus affecting the transmission accuracy
The above-mentioned various effects lead to low positioning accuracy, and the general positioning accuracy of ±0.1mm cannot guarantee high-precision workpiece processing requirements

[0020] The features of the present invention and other related features will be further described in detail below in conjunction with the accompanying drawings through embodiments, so as to facilitate the understanding of those skilled in the art:

[0021] Such as figure 1 As shown in -5, the labels 1-17 respectively represent: ball screw 1, slider 2, connecting plate 3, end cover 4, dustproof plate 5, opening 6, U-shaped frame 7, slide seat 8, slide rail 9, Support base 10, servo motor 11, synchronous toothed belt 12, synchronous toothed belt shaft 13, motor interface 14, ball screw actuator assembly 15, synchronous toothed belt actuator assembly 16, pressure block 17.

[0022] This embodiment is a frame structure composed of four ball screw actuator assemblies 15 and two synchronous toothed belt actuator assemblies 16, in which four ball screw actuator assemblies 15 are used for the X axis and the R axis Assembled, the Z1 and Z2 shafts are assembled by two synchronous tooth...

Abstract

The invention relates to a detachable assembled back-positioning device used in digital-control plate bender, belonging to the device for processing metallic plate. Wherein, it uses integrated initiator elements to form a frame-type structure, while each element uses full-sealed transmission structures, to avoid the defects of present technique. The invention has the advantages that: the production is standard, with reliable quality, stable operation, high transmission accuracy, high positioning accuracy and high transmission speed.
